Scratch One

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One (USA 2023)

From the Publisher:
From the creator of Jurassic Park and ER
A pulp-fiction thrill ride through a deadly case of mistaken identity

Playboy Roger Carr is handsome, wealthy, and connected. As an occasional lawyer, he's the right man to send to the French Riviera to secure a villa for an important client. It's the perfect assignment, complete with fast cars and fast women, until strange things begin to happen and Roger realizes that someone is trying to kill him.

A ruthless terrorist organization called the Associates is carrying out assassinations from Egypt to Denmark. To stop them, the CIA orders their own super assassin -- a man who bears a striking resemblance to Roger Carr -- to intercept the Associates in France. The CIA assassin never shows up, but the clueless counselor does, and now he finds himself on the run from some of the world's deadliest terrorists.

With a new introduction by Sherri Crichton

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One. Blackstone Publishing, ISBN: 9798200987580 (December, 2023), 268 p., Hardcover $24.99, eBook $9.99.

Scratch One

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One (UK 2013)

From the Publisher:
Murder stalks the French Riviera
To prevent an arms shipment from reaching the Middle East, a terrorist group has been carrying out targeted assassinations in Egypt, Portugal, Denmark, and France. In response, the US sends one of its deadliest agents to take the killers down. But when the agent is delayed in transit, lawyer Roger Carr gets mistaken for him.

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One. Titan Books / Hard Case Crime, ISBN: 9781783291199 (October, 2013), 268 p., $9.95.

Scratch One

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One (USA 2013)

From the Publisher:
Mistaken for a secret agent, a hapless lawyer scrambles to stay alive
An arms dealer in Copenhagen dies after sipping a poisoned martini. An American diplomat in Lisbon is shot in the back of the head. A Frenchman survives being pushed in front of a train, only to be murdered in his hospital bed. Though seemingly unconnected, these events are part of an international conspiracy that could spell death for Roger Carr.

Carr is a lawyer, but he has no love for Lady Justice. A dilettante playboy sent to France on a cushy assignment, he lands himself right in the middle of an international arms deal. Both sides of the conflict have mistaken him for an agent, and the secret service interventions of a dozen countries will do anything to secure him -- dead or alive.

This ebook features an illustrated biography of Michael Crichton including rare images from the author's estate.

Michael Crichton writing as John Lange: Scratch One. A Novel. Open Road Media, ISBN: 9781453299241 (July, 2013), eBook, 7 MB (ca. 217 p.), $7.99.

Scratch One

John Lange: Scratch One (USA ca. 1970)

From the Publisher:
Fast cars, women, double-dealing -- a young American finds that speed can kill on the bloody Côte d'Azur

TOURIST TRAP Roger Carr was not a typical tourist. He was young, handsome, rich, and phenomenally successful with women, and the Riviera was his favorite playground.

But the trap wasn't ordinary either. It was designed by a brilliant, sadistic French surgeon, manned by a supremely efficient German killer, and set to destroy Carr from the moment he arrived in Nice.

Unfortunately for Carr, the bait was the one thing he could not resist. Her name was Anne, and she was poison -- but in such a tempting package...

John Lange: Scratch One. NAL / Signet T4353, 3rd Printing ca. 1970, 192 p., ¢75.
